
Wise, VA - Hannah Powers a junior college standout from Chattanooga State community college has become the first signee in the 2010 class for the University of Virginia's College at Wise. The 5'6" point guard will come to UVA Wise as a junior in eligibility and join a roster that will return four starters from this season's 16 win team.
Powers led her Chattanooga State team to a conference quarterfinal finish while averaging 11 points per game and 3 assists. In addition to her skills at point guard, she will be an added threat from behind the arc as her 38% placed her fifth in the conference in three-point percentage.
The Tellico Planes Tennessee native is a graduate of Monroe County high school where she had an outstanding prep career. During her senior season she averaged 17 points, five assists, and seven rebounds per game while being named All-District and All-Region.
